How much do Christmas & New Years Tours in Zimbabwe cost?

The average price per day for Christmas & New Years tours in Zimbabwe is $374, based on our analysis of 81 tours. While the overall prices can vary greatly, when we look at the daily price of these tours, the costs range from $124 to $1,720 per day.

Budget-friendly tours average around $179 per day, while higher-end luxury tours average about $628 per day.

Budget tours will usually provide less luxurious accommodation, have larger group sizes, and visit less expensive destinations. They will also sometimes have you pay for more activities on your own instead of including everything up front.

Mid-range tours often provide a step up in accommodation and transportation, and include more guided activities.

Luxury tours usually provide the highest levels of service, luxury hotels, more gormet food choices, comfortable transportation, and offer more all-inclusive payment options.

Which is cheaper?

Is independent travel cheaper than guided Christmas & New Years tours? The answer is not simple. Tours provide many of the services that you would otherwise pay for yourself on an independent trip. Hotels, transportation, food, entry tickets, guides, and activities are provided on organized tours, whereas you would pay for everything separately on your own. To deterine the difference in price, you would need to compare the combined price of everything in a tour with everything you would book separately. Sometimes you might want to stay in a cheaper hotel, or eat at a more expensive restaurant, so the price of a tour could be more or less than what you would otherwise pay on your own. Make sure you know what is included before making your comparison.
